The aim of our project is to solve problems related to the
conservation of indigenous and wild species in Lonjsko polje. Introducing
visitors to endangered species and their numbers and protection against
extinction.

This problem mainly affects the surrounding population, but indirectly also the population of a large part of our country. Namely, the river Lonja, which flows through Lonjsko polje, is rich in numerous fish species that feed the local population, and it flows into the river Sava, which for most of its course passes through central Croatia (Slavonia). The local community is gaining in importance for the protection of flora and fauna of this park. If there are negative consequences, it can negatively affect people who work in tourism.
Unconscious visitors to the nature park are responsible for this problem, but also the local population. In addition to the human factor, a major problem is climate change, which affects changes in habitats and temperatures to which certain animals do not have a developed adaptation.
The problem is big because the extinction of certain species disrupts the entire ecosystem. Disruption of the ecosystem loses the balance of species and reduces biodiversity. Biodiversity change affects the food chain, but also forces local people to change their activities
We believe that it is important to protect natural areas such as the Lonjsko Polje Nature Park by informing about endangered species that live there, and there are many problems along the way. It is estimated that nature in Croatia is endangered mainly due to human activity, which is manifested in the modification of natural ecosystems, the use of biological resources and pollution. Dam and water management / use and other ecosystem modifications, wastewater from agriculture, forestry and municipal wastewater, and the construction of residential and urban areas are problematic. Human activities mostly result in habitat loss and degradation. By banning these activities in this protected area, we are trying to protect the biodiversity of the Lonjsko Polje Nature Park.
